Thirteen-year-old Armond Costa heals in three days, no matter what abuse his uncle and aunt inflict upon him. On his fourteenth birthday, he sprouts wings and discovers his aunt and uncle had lied to him. He's the lost Golden Demon's Healer. His father, King of the Golden Demons, insists he return with him and save his people from being persecuted by their mortal enemies, the Dark Demons. Now, Armond must choose between the Ellis brothers and seventeen-year-old Rusty Owens -- the only family he's ever known -- or condemn the Golden Demons to extinction. Complete book. No cliffhanger. This is a teen and young adult paranormal and dark fantasy novel. The series centers on a teen who discovers he can heal both humans and demons. It centers around social issues, coming of age, and friendship. There are vampires, demons, and magic. These are stand alone books that create a series and do not need to be read in order.

LOVED THIS SERIES By linda Although this book is rated YA I have no doubt that it would appeal to adults as well, it did to me.All his life Armond Costa grew up with his Uncle Peter and his Aunt Janet Martin along with his two cousins Larry and Bobby. Armond can never remember a time that he wasn't savagely beaten by the people who should have loved him. He was chained to a wall whipped, kicked, bones broken and he had the ability to heal inself in three days when the torture would begin all over again. He was told that his mother wants him dead since she is a healer and doesn't want another healer around especially her own son. It was his mother's boyfriend who killed his father and now they want him dead as well.The only reason that Armond did not give up was due to his friends, Rusty a wise guy kid who would protect Armond whenever he needed him. Then there were the men he considered to be his real family the Ellises, Kyle, Evan and Darin. It was their home he ran to when he needed protection and although there was little they could do they were always there for him. Larry the Martin's son also did whatever he could to ease Armond's pain in spite of the fear his parents would punish him.The last torture Armond suffered was by far the worst because at midnight when he turned fourteen his uncle appeared with a chain saw in hand and when Armond found himself sprouting wings they were immediately cut off. With Larry and Rusty's help he manages to get away and find shelter with the Ellis family. Darin threatens the Martin's and does his best to keep Armond safe. Unfortunately when the neighbors dog is almost killed and Armond finds himself healing it, it becomes a news worthy story. Fearing he will be found by his mother he realizes that there is nowhere he can hide especially when three men charge through the doors of the Ellis home.One of the three men is the King of the Golden Demons, Gregori who also admits to being Armond's father. Gregori wants Armond to return with him to Havenwood where his ability to heal is needed. The Golden Demons are at war with the Dark Demons led by Ryker and with their healer they are able to save most of their men where as the Golden Demons cannot. If this keeps up much longer the Golden Demons will no longer exist. Darin agrees to accompany Armond to Havenwood and allow him to visit on weekends to tend to the dying. When he meets his mother he is full of doubt, who can he trust.In addition to his father and mother he meets his twin brother Darius and his other brother Lucien. Each of the boys has a gift, Lucien is a empath and Darius is a runner (he can run faster than light). Armond does not want to see anyone dying and agrees to heal but he does not agree to trust. All his life he learned that trust usually meant pain. Can Armond finally find love and trust those around him? Will he agree to stay at Havenwood to help? The Dark Demons have a healer, Ryker''s own son Gunnar but when Armond meets Gunnar he realizes that Gunnar is in the same situation he was in but instead of his uncle and aunt beating him it is his father.There are secrets and surprises and it is a story of learning to trust. Every character in the book is wonderful not counting the Dark Demons of course.Reviewed by: Linda TonisMember of the Paranormal Romance Review Team

0 of 0 people found the following review helpful. Dare To Trust is a Keeper on my Kindle By Karalee Long J. L. Bowen’s young adult, fantasy novel Dare To Trust kept me turning the pages to the end, and I wanted more.In the contemporary Denver, Colorado area, thirteen-year-old Armand Costa lives with his aunt and uncle and their two adolescent boys. Armand doesn’t understand why he is often severely beaten by his aunt and uncle and why he always heals in three days. And things only get worse when he turns fourteen – and sprouts wings.When faced with what and who he really is, Armand has several heart wrenching decisions to make. Who should he believe? What kind of individual will he become? Will he accept his destiny?Throughout the book Bowen is spot on with the emotions, anxieties, fears, and behaviors of teenagers, and the adults are just as authentic. The characters are so real, I wanted to meet them in person. Well, not every one of them.Fortunately, this is the first book in Bowen’s Dark Choices Series, and I’m looking forward to reading them all.
